100-year-old Piaf hailed in Paris – Swedish Dagbladet

Edith Piaf 1959. Photo: Matty Zimmerman / AP

– You must continue, says singer Malene Lamarque, performing Piaf songs every week on a of the city’s many cabaret premises.

According to her, Piaf songs been of great assistance during the period following the terrorist attacks.

– They have given joy and fellowship but also comforting, she says.

Le Bataclan, the site for the bloodiest attack, was also a concert hall where Piaf herself appeared.

The celebration will continue until the New Year in different parts of the city. In St. Jean le Baptiste church where Piaf was baptized, held an exhibition and concert in her honor. Praises, however on a smaller scale compared to when the 50th anniversary of her death highlighted two years ago.

Edith Piaf (1915-1963) is known for songs like “La vie en rose” and “Non, je ne regrette rien “.
